Are visible tattoos allowed in the workplace?
For instance, some companies may allow visible tattoos as long as there is no profane language or graphic imagery. Some organizations may allow tattoos on certain parts of the body, like arms and legs, but not on other parts, like the neck or hands. Other companies might strictly forbid visible tattoos altogether.

Can I be discriminated against for tattoos?
There are no current laws that prohibit employers from discriminating against people with visible tattoos.
